Output 95a56c901b129c267d4312978e4ff5d3d18771c8f1101b42c74478ed0585a624:1

value
26336289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9180173418a07cc56d1f775163dea67b92fd92ea OP_EQUALVERIFY OP_CHECKSIG
address
1EGLRi87ftKCvsNQEDsQvELLvf6s76rcBk
transaction
95a56c901b129c267d4312978e4ff5d3d18771c8f1101b42c74478ed0585a624
confirmations
358348
spent
true